Is CENTRAL MARKET BRAISED BRISKET, BY LB Vegan?

No. This product is not vegan as it lists 9 ingredients that derive from animals and 3 ingredients could could derive from animals depending on the source. We recommend contacting the manufacturer directly to confirm.

Ingredients

braised brisket (beef brisket, beef stock from base (water, beef base (roast beef, beef stock, salt, hydrolyzed protein (soy, corn), sugar, corn oil, autolyzed yeast extract, corn starch, caramel color, natural flavor, maltodextrin, disodium guanylate, disodium inosinate, corn syrup solids, beef extract, dextrose, beef fat)), yellow onion, celery, ketchup (tomato concentrate, distilled vinegar, high fructose corn syrup, corn syrup, salt, spices, onion powder, natural flavor), red wine (sulfites), nutra clear oil (canola oil), worcestershire (distilled vinegar, molasses, water, corn syrup, salt, caramel color, sugar, spices, anchovies, natural flavor (soy), tamarind extract), garlic, kosher salt, thyme, black pepper, rosemary, bay leaves), ***KEEP REFRIGERATED***

What is a Vegan diet?

A vegan diet excludes all animal-derived foods, including meat, poultry, fish, dairy, eggs, and honey. It focuses on plant-based sources such as fruits, vegetables, grains, legumes, nuts, and seeds. Many people choose veganism for ethical, environmental, or health reasons. When well-planned, it provides sufficient protein, fiber, and antioxidants, though supplementation or fortified foods may be needed for nutrients like vitamin B12, iron, and omega-3 fatty acids. Vegan diets are associated with lower risks of heart disease and improved digestion but require mindfulness to ensure balanced and complete nutrition.
